Blk 19 Jln Tenteram is an HDB block in Kallang/Whampoa (completed in 1999, 28 storeys, 107 units). As of Jul 2026, its median resale price over the last 24 months is $734,500, about 11% above the Kallang/Whampoa median, from 8 sales. 77 resale transactions have been recorded here since 1990.

Median monthly rent at this block: $3,800/mo (5 rental contracts, last 12 months).
Estimated gross rental yield: ~6.2% (Kallang/Whampoa average: ~6.2%) — annual median rent over median resale price, before taxes, fees and vacancy.
On price per square metre, this block is cheaper than 31% of Kallang/Whampoa blocks with recent sales.
For a typical 5-room flat here, our price model estimates $797,268–$891,859 (central estimate $844,563). Recent sales — median $812,269 — sit within that range. The model explains 94% of resale prices with a typical error of ±6%. Indicative only — not an official valuation.
